A187618 Triangle T(m,n) read by rows: number of domino tilings of the 2m X 2n grid (0 <= m <= n).

%e A187618 Triangle begins:
%e A187618 1
%e A187618 1       2
%e A187618 1       5       36
%e A187618 1       13      281     6728
%e A187618 1       34      2245    167089  12988816
%e A187618 1       89      ...
